Anker PowerCore 20100 vs Goal Zero Nomad 10

Weight and specs compared for 2026 — and which one to choose.

Goal Zero Nomad 10 is the lighter option — 73 g lighter than the Anker PowerCore 20100 (21% less weight). If grams matter to you, that is the one to beat.

Anker PowerCore 20100 vs Goal Zero Nomad 10: which should you buy?

If saving weight is your priority, the Goal Zero Nomad 10 wins — at 283 g it is 73 g (21%) lighter than the Anker PowerCore 20100 (356 g). That said, the heavier option may justify the extra grams with more capacity, durability or comfort, so weigh the trade-off against how you'll use it.
